  16. Mmmm... not exactly. That would be combo would be 4BB4B. Another example is: 横>NN前>特射 (I pulled this from the JP Wiki for Zeta) Which is: 6B > 5BB8B > AC Note that the "N" you see after a kanji is like another button input to continue a melee string. So something like NNN = 5BBB or 横N = 6BB.

  20. Here are some cancels you can do: 2B -> Sub (turnaround freefall cancel aka usakyan; must have ammo) CSa/CSb -> BC (goes into MA mode; good for evasion)
